New Orleans doom/sludge metal supergroup Down have announced their fourth full-length album, Volume V, due for release on 20th November via Nuclear Blast Records. The band shared the lead single "Blood Oath" alongside the announcement, marking their first major new music since returning guitarist Kirk Weinstein rejoined the line-up. The release matters as a notable return for a band that, despite huge critical and commercial standing, has released only three albums and two EPs across its 35-year history.

Frontman Philip Anselmo described the recording process as energised and focused, while Weinstein said the sessions recaptured the spirit of the band's 1995 debut NOLA. The ten-track record includes "Merciful Fate", featuring King Diamond and his wife Livia Zita, and "Ozz", a tribute to the late Ozzy Osbourne. Down are currently touring North America with Helmet and Spirit in the Room, and are also set to appear at Zakk Wylde's Berzerkus festival.
